Well, seeing that it was my birthday recently and I got some money - I decided to buy a Wii U
I ended up with the 32GB Premium Pack, Nintendo Land, ZombiU, Lego City Undercover, Pro Controller and a Remote Plus I already have a Wii so have 2 normal white remotes/nunchucks.
The whole lot came to under £290, which included using an Amazon voucher from TCB - although interestingly the price of the premium console went up a few days ago from £199 to £245. The £199 price tag was one reason why I purchased the controller and ZombiU separately because it worked out way cheaper than the bundle PLUS you get Nintendo Land as well.
So far so good I have done the transfer from the old console to the new one - Miis, game saves, DLCs - without a hitch. It is backwards compatible with all Wii games and controllers.
As for the gaming experience, pretty darn good so far - with the Gamepad really making a difference to certain games, plus of course allowing a rather unique multiplayer experience.
